For many individuals detected with Attention-Deficit/Hyperactivity Disorder (ADHD), pharmacological intervention works as a foundation of their treatment plan. Nevertheless, receiving a prescription is just the initial step in a complicated clinical journey called medication titration. Unlike lots of basic medications where a "one-size-fits-all" dosage applies based upon weight or age, ADHD medications need a highly personalized approach.

The titration procedure is a structured, collaborative period during which a health care service provider and a client interact to find the optimum medication and dosage. The primary goal is to optimize the decrease of ADHD signs-- such as inattentiveness, hyperactivity, and impulsivity-- while reducing adverse adverse effects.

Comprehending the Concept of "Start Low and Go Slow"

The main viewpoint governing ADHD medication titration is "start low and go slow." Due to the fact that neurochemistry varies substantially from individual to individual, a dose that is effective for one grownup may be overstimulating for another of the very same size.

The titration period allows the main nerve system to adjust to the medication. By beginning with the lowest possible healing dose, clinicians can monitor the body's response and slowly increase the amount up until the "therapeutic window" is reached. This window is the particular dosage range where the specific experiences the greatest practical improvement with the fewest disturbances to their lifestyle.

The Different Paths of Titration: Stimulants vs. Non-Stimulants

The timeline and methodology of titration differ substantially depending upon the class of medication prescribed. Generally, ADHD medications fall under two categories: stimulants and non-stimulants.

Contrast of Titration Profiles

FunctionStimulant Medications (e.g., Methylphenidate, Amphetamines)Non-Stimulant Medications (e.g., Atomoxetine, Guanfacine)
Onset of ActionQuick (typically within 30-- 60 minutes).Gradual (takes 2-- 6 weeks to reach complete effect).
Titration SpeedFrequency of dosage changes can be weekly.Dosage modifications typically happen every 2-- 4 weeks.
Tracking IntervalDaily tracking of instant peak and crash.Monitoring for steady-state accumulation.
Common ExamplesAdderall, Ritalin, Concerta, Vyvanse.Strattera, Intuniv, Qelbree.

The Step-by-Step Titration Process

The titration process is hardly ever a straight line; it frequently involves adjustments, observations, and often, a change in medication completely.

1. Standard Assessment

Before the first tablet is taken, the clinician establishes a standard. This involves making use of standardized ranking scales (such as the Vanderbilt or ASRS scales) to quantify the intensity of current symptoms. Crucial signs, including blood pressure and heart rate, are also recorded.

2. The Initial Dose

The patient begins with the most affordable offered dosage. During this phase, the objective is not necessarily symptom total relief, but rather to guarantee the medication is endured by the body without significant adverse reactions.

3. Organized Monitoring

Patients are typically asked to keep an everyday log or utilize a tracking app. This information is essential for the clinician to identify if the dose is working. Secret metrics consist of:

  • Changes in focus and job conclusion.
  • Emotional guideline and irritability.
  • Physical signs (headaches, heart rate).

4. Incremental Adjustments

If the initial dose provides some advantage but signs remain invasive, the clinician will increase the dosage. This step is duplicated-- generally at intervals of 7 to fourteen days for stimulants-- up until the optimal dosage is determined.

5. Upkeep and Stabilization

Once the optimum dose is discovered, the client goes into the upkeep stage. Routine follow-ups (every 3 to 6 months) guarantee that the medication remains effective and that no long-lasting negative effects, such as weight loss or blood pressure modifications, are occurring.

What to Observe: A Checklist for Patients and Caregivers

Success in titration depends greatly on the quality of feedback supplied to the physician. Observation ought to concentrate on a number of key locations of everyday functioning.

Secret Indicators of a Successful Dose:

  • Improved Task Initiation: Finding it much easier to start dull or complicated tasks.
  • Improved Sustained Attention: The capability to remain on task for an affordable period without distraction.
  • Lowered Impulsivity: Thinking before acting or speaking.
  • Emotional Stability: Feeling more "in control" of emotions rather than experiencing a "medication fog."
  • Consistency: The medication offers a predictable level of assistance every day.

Common Side Effects to Monitor:

  • Appetite Suppression: A substantial decline in appetite, frequently leading to "rebound appetite" when the medication disappears.
  • Insomnia: Difficulty falling asleep, particularly if the dosage is taken too late in the day.
  • Xerostomia (Dry Mouth): A typical physical side impact.
  • The "Crash": An increase in irritation or tiredness as the medication leaves the system.
  • Increased Heart Rate: A sensation of heart palpitations or "jitteriness."

Aspects That Influence the Titration Timeline

The period of the titration process can range from a few weeks to a number of months. A number of elements influence the length of time it takes to reach stabilization:

  1. Metabolic Variance: Genetic elements affect how rapidly the liver metabolizes certain drugs (enzymes like CYP2D6). "Fast metabolizers" may need higher or more regular doses, while "slow metabolizers" might experience adverse effects at extremely low doses.
  2. Co-occurring Conditions: The existence of stress and anxiety, depression, or sleep disorders can complicate titration, as ADHD medications may worsen or ease these symptoms.
  3. Lifestyle Factors: Diet (especially acidic foods and Vitamin C for particular stimulants), caffeine intake, and sleep hygiene all communicate with medication efficacy.
  4. Hormone Fluctuations: For females, hormone modifications throughout the menstrual cycle can impact the efficiency of ADHD medications, in some cases requiring dose changes throughout particular weeks of the month.

Frequently Asked Questions (FAQ)

How long does the titration procedure generally take?

For stimulants, titration typically lasts between 4 to 8 weeks. For non-stimulants, since they require time to develop in the blood stream, the process can take 8 to 12 weeks to figure out the complete therapeutic impact.

What occurs if the adverse effects are too strong?

If adverse effects are intolerable, the clinician may lower the dose, try a different shipment system (e.g., changing from immediate-release to extended-release), or switch to a different class of medication (e.g., changing from an amphetamine-based drug to a methylphenidate-based drug).

Can an individual skip doses during titration?

Generally, it is advised to take the medication daily during titration to acquire an accurate understanding of its impacts. Avoiding dosages can make it tough for the clinician to compare the medication's effect and the natural fluctuations of ADHD symptoms.

Does a higher dose indicate the ADHD is "worse"?

No. Dose is not a reflection of the seriousness of ADHD. It is totally a reflection of a person's distinct neurochemistry and metabolism. A person with "moderate" ADHD might need a high dosage, while an individual with "serious" signs may be highly conscious a low dosage.

What is the "Honeymoon Phase"?

Some clients experience a period of bliss or extreme clearness throughout the very first couple of days of a brand-new medication or dosage. This often levels off as the brain adjusts. Titration go for sustainable, long-term focus, not the temporary "ambiance" of the very first couple of days.
